INSIDE THE MATCHUP
This is the 16th meeting between Davidson and Saint Joseph's. The Wildcats are 11-4 against the Hawks. The Hawks won the last game, 78-61, on January 21, 2025. Sam Brown is set to face his former head coach Steve Donahue. Donahue was the head coach at Penn when Sam played there from 2023-25.
LAST GAME
The 'Cats fell in their A-10 opener to Duquesne on December 30 at home 89-83 in double overtime. Parker Friedrichsen matched a career high with 19 points. Sam Brown scored a season-high 23 points, becoming the second Wildcat this season to surpass the 20-point mark in the 2025-26 campaign. Roberts Blums scored a career-high 17 points. This was Davidson's first double overtime contest since 2022 (W, 102-97 at Wright State).
Stephen Curry returned to Davidson and was honored during the game. The town of Davidson now has a "Stephen Curry Interchange" entrance sign located near Exit 30 on I-77.
A-10 INSIGHT
Over the last 9 seasons (not including COVID year), the league has had 8 different schools win the conference tournament title. In the previous 8 years, eight different programs have won an A-10 regular season title. The last two seasons featured co-regular season champs (George Mason/VCU - 2025 | Loyola Chicago/Richmond - 2024).
Saint Louis and George Mason both posted the best records (12-1) during non-conference play this season. 12 of the 14 A-10 schools have winning records entering conference play.
Davidson was picked 11th and Saint Joseph's was picked 7th in the A-10 Preseason Polls this season.
BALANCE
Davidson has 9 scholar-athletes who average at least 15 minutes per game this season. The 'Cats rank 13th in the nation in bench points per game this season as of Dec. 31.
SECURE THE ROCK
Davidson averages the fewest turnovers per game in the A-10 this season (10.5).
DOWNTOWN RANGE
Hunter Adam is first in the A-10 in three-point field goal percentage (48.9). Adam has made 23 triples this season, which is already more than last year's total (16).
BLUMS IS BLOSSOMING
Roberts Blums leads the 'Cats with 10.5 points per game this season. The sophomore has come off the bench in all 13 games and has led the team in scoring in 7 of these contests. Blums has scored 136 points this season, which is already more than his point total from all of last season (134 points in 31 games).
